With the increasing cars and number of residents in Beijing, the shortage of urban road capacity has become increasingly conspicuous. In this paper, public transportation network evaluation factors such as the length of bus lines, line density, repeated factor, non-linear coefficient, site density, the average station distance and Geographic Information Systems (GIS) technology will be used to evaluate the public transportation network in Beijing inside of the 5th ring road to make appropriate improvements. In addition, the article conducts evaluation of the network to reveal the existing problems to find a reasonable solution and further develop the line optimization program. Finally, the results are used to improve public transportation ground to lay the foundation of operational efficiency.
